super 在Java继承中的作用?

2023-06-14 04:40

3个回答
Java中的关键字super:调用父类的属性,一个类中如芦歼激果有int x属性,如果其子类中也定义了int x属性的话,在子类中调用父类的x属性时应用super.x=6,表示该x是引用陪袜的父类的属性,而要表示子类中的x属性的话,使用this.x。

Java里在子类中用super调用父类构造函数时,调用函数必须放在子类的第一条语句的位置,如果改唯想用super继承父类构造的方法,但是没有放在第一 行的话,那么在super之前的语句,也许是为了满足自己想要完成某些行为的语句,但是又用了super继承父类的构造方法,以前所做的修改就都回到以前 了,也就是说又成了父类的构造方法了。
可以使用父类的信息,因为有些方法子类被重写...
这个很有意思,不过我先说的是this这笑或个关键字,比如说Man 继承Person,当你创建一个Man的清洞时候,也就是new Man ,this就是指向这个新创出来的Man对象,而创建Man的同时也会创建一个Person,而这个super就是用来指向Person的,这个属内存里面的知识,理解一下更好明白继承和多态,不知道我解释的怎碰正伍么样,希望您能明白,祝你NB
相关问答
java继承的一道题
1个回答2023-07-13 14:25
1、一共三个类,Depend,Test1——继承自Depend,Test。 2、运行顺序是,运行Test,实例化了Test1,又因为Test1继承自Depend,所以蚂郑纳实例化Depend。先初始化...
全文
java中继承的好处是什么,在组合和继承中该如何取舍?
3个回答2023-07-07 05:10
首先腔燃继承,如果多个类用的方法(变量)是伍枯虚一样的,在类中每次多要赋值这样的方法很麻烦,代码的利用率差. 这些公用的方法(变量)可以提前写好在A类(父类)中,然后我们要用的类B类(子类)继承,然后...
全文
java 中子类重写继承的方法的规则是什么
2个回答2023-01-07 00:25
如果在子类中定义某方法与其父类有相同的名称和参数,我们说该方法被重写 如果在一个类中定义了多个同名的方法,它们或有不同的参数个数或有不同的参数类型,则称为方法的重载
《继承者们》都有哪些继承者?他们分别是谁?他们继承了什么?
1个回答2024-03-10 09:27
李敏镐饰演金叹(男主)帝国集团私生子,继承者朴信惠饰演车恩尚(女主)贫穷继承者金宇彬饰演崔英道(男二)宙斯酒店继承者,金叹以前的好朋友金智媛饰演刘Rachel(女二)RS国际的继承者,金叹的未婚妻姜...
全文
java 继承和new有什么区别?我感觉要达成的目的都是一样的,而且只能继承一个类,还不如new呢
3个回答2022-12-30 18:38
从逻辑上讲,继承是包含的关系,也就是说你可以拿到父类的权限之内的方法、变量等,但是你必须实现一些抽象类等,也可以覆盖父类的方法;而new的呢,是你实例化了某个类,比如你实例化了父类,你只能拿到它权限内...
全文
第一继承人在 第二继承人是否可以继承
1个回答2022-10-04 06:26
不能,继承要按照继承顺序的,第一顺位继承人在的话第二顺位继承人不能继承。
被继承人和继承人的区别是什么啊?
2个回答2022-09-04 19:40
简单说被继承人就是已故的人!继承人就是和被继承人有着血缘关系或姻亲关系等具有法律规定范围内享有继承权的在世的人!
继承者们继承人是何意思
1个回答2023-03-31 22:31
继承家业,就是富二代。父母老了,会把所有资金留给孩子。孩子就叫继承者
第一继承人和其实继承人有什么不同
1个回答2023-01-21 15:25
第十条 遗产按照下列顺序继承:   第一顺序:配偶、子女、父母。   第二顺序:兄弟姐妹、祖父母、外祖父母。 继承开始后,由第一顺序继承人继承,第二顺序继承人不继承。没有第一顺序继承人继承的,由第二顺...
全文
哈喽,继承者们好看吗 哈喽,继承者们怎么样
1个回答2023-05-23 10:05
个人反正是没有看过了 可能这个剧情不太符合我的口味吧 每个人的看法都是不一样的了 你要问你自己喜不喜欢看了 你还是亲自去看几集再下结论吧
扫码下载APP
听书听课听播客,随时随地陪伴你
热门问答